Output 7d20efd343a5a151a5f40662599959aabcf9655c664fe7a666ab3be2065d34d5:0

value
24276
script pubkey
OP_0 OP_PUSHBYTES_20 edfcff8405946a8d778661a3cf9b94d5c685b275
address
bc1qah70lpq9j34g6auxvx3ulxu56hrgtvn4l0a62s
transaction
7d20efd343a5a151a5f40662599959aabcf9655c664fe7a666ab3be2065d34d5
spent
true